文谷首页 | 业界传真 | 网络技术 | 服务器 | 数据库 | 存储技术 | 系统安全 | 无线技术 | Cisco | .Net | Windows | Linux | Unix | Java
电子商务 | 网站工程 | 网页设计 | 平面设计 | 多媒体 | 编程语言 | Oracle | MSSQL | Photoshop | ASP | PHP | 实用技巧 | 进程查询 | 文谷论坛
Java频道
 资讯动态   考试认证   新手入门   核心技术   高级技术   J2EE   J2ME   XML   开源技术   其他技术
您现在的位置: IT文谷 >> 开发平台 >> Java >> 考试认证 >> 考试介绍 >> 文章正文
SCJP 中文大纲SCJP 中文大纲2006-7-18 22:56:58SCJP 中文大纲2006-7-18 22:56:58SCJP 中文大纲
SCJP 中文大纲
SCJP 中文大纲SCJP 中文大纲2006-7-18 22:56:58SCJP 中文大纲2006-7-18 22:56:58SCJP 中文大纲
SCJP 中文大纲SCJP 中文大纲2006-7-18 22:56:58SCJP 中文大纲2006-7-18 22:56:58SCJP 中文大纲

  请点击这里到SUN栏目下载Word文档!
  
  SUN JAVA2认证程序员 平台1.4
  
  第一部分:声明和访问控制
  
  声明,构建,初始化任何类型的数组
  声明类,内部类,方法,成员变量,静态成员变量和方法变量,并会应用任何合法的修饰符(如
  public,final,static,abstract,等等)。能够
  
  明了这些修饰符单独和组合起来的含义,并且知道被修饰符修饰的任意对象在各种包相关联系下
  的影响。
  
  
  第二部分:流程控制,断言和异常处理
  
  能够正确使用if,switch语句并且在这些语句中能正确使用合法的参数类型。
  能够正确使用所有带标签或不带标签的循环语句,能使用break,continue,能计算在循环中或循
  环后循环计数器的值。
  能够正确使用异常和异常处理语句(try,catch,finally)。能正确声明掷出例外的方法,并知道
  怎样覆盖它。
  知道在程序段的特定点出现的异常对程序的影响。即:异常可能是一个runtime exception,一个
  checked exception也可能是一个error。(这
  
  个程序段可能包括try,catch,finally并以任何可能的合法组合出现。)。
  
  能正确应用断言,区分正确使用的断言和不正确的。
  明白关于断言机制的正确说法。
  
  
  第三部分:垃圾收集
  
  明白垃圾收集机制确定性的行为。
  能用程序显式的使一个对象能被垃圾收集器合法的收集。
  知道在程序的哪一点垃圾收集器能合法地收集一个对象。
  
  
  第四部分:语言基础
  
  
  能正确构建包声明,import声明,类声明(包括内部类),接口声明,方法声明(包括用于开始
  一个类的执行的main方法),变量声明及其其
  
  它的一些说明符。
  能够正确使用一些类,这些类要么实现了java.lang.Runnable这个接口,要么能正确实现在问题
  中构建的一些接口。
  知道传入main函数的命令行参数的index value。
  知道所有JAVA的keyword。注意:考试中不会出现要你区分keyword和各种常数这类深奥的问题。
  
  明白如果没有显式地赋值的各种变量或者数组被使用会出现什么结果。
  
  知道所有原始数据类型的取值范围,怎样声明一个String的字面值等等。
  
  
  第五部分:操作与赋值
  
  能知道当任何操作符(包括赋值操作符和intanceof操作符)应用于任何操作数(任何类型的类或
  访问能力或两者的任意组合)的结果。
  知道String,Boolean和Object类使用equals(Object)方法后的结果。
  知道当对已经知道值的变量进行&,|,&&,||操作时,哪些操作数被运算了,表达式最终的结果是怎
  样的。
  知道Object和原始类型数据传入方法的不同方式,知道如何在这些方法中如何进行赋值或其它修
  改操作。
  
  
  第六部分:覆盖,重载,运行时期类型及其面向对象
  
  知道面向对象设计中封装的好处并能用程序实现紧密封装的类,能知道is a和has a的意义。
  
  能正确使用覆盖和重载的方法,能正确调用父类或覆盖了的构建器,知道调用这些方法后的结
  果。
  能实例化任何具体的一般顶层类和内部类。
  
  
  第七部分:线程
  
  能用java.lang,Thread和java.lang.Runnable两种方法定义,实例化和开始一个新的线程。
  
  知道哪些情况下可能阻止一个线程的执行。
  
  能使用synchronized,wait,notify和notifyAll去解决避免同时访问及其线程间相互通讯的问题。
  
  当执行synchronized,wait,notify和notifyAll时,知道线程和对象锁之间的交互作用。
  
  
  第八部分:在java.lang包中的基础类
  
  能够应用Math类中的abs,ceil,floor,max,min,random,round,sin,cos,tan,sqrt方法。
  正确描述String类不可改变的意义。
  当执行一段程序,中间包含有wrapper类的一个实例,知道它运行的前提条件运行结果。能用下面
  wrapper类(例如Integer,Double,等等)的方
  
  法来写程序:
  doublevalue
  floatvalue
  intvalue
  longvalue
  parseXxx
  getXxx
  toString
  toHexString
  
  
  第九部分:集合类框架
  
  知道如何在特定的条件下选择适合的集合类/接口。
  区分正确和不正确对hashcode方法的实现。

SCJP 中文大纲SCJP 中文大纲2006-7-18 22:56:58SCJP 中文大纲2006-7-18 22:56:58SCJP 中文大纲
  • 上一篇文章:

  • 下一篇文章:
  • 进入论坛讨论

    相关文章
    CCNA实验模拟器系列]思科网络技术学院FLASH实验介绍
    [CCNA实验模拟器系列] Boson NetSim破解下载图例
    [CCNA考试模拟系统系列] CertSim 破解下载图例
    主流CCNA实验模拟器介绍(2004版)
    CCNA专业英文词汇全集
    CCNA认证考试折扣号申请说明
    一句话Q&A:我有必要在考CCDA之前先取得CCNA认证吗?
    一句话Q&A:第一次参加Cisco考试,没有通过的话能不能重考?
    一句话Q&A:CCNA证书有效期和再认证考试怎么考?
    一句话Q&A:CCNA的培训一般是多长时间?
    一句话Q&A:CCNA和MCSE需要多少英语基础和专业基础知识?
    MCSE与CCNA的比较
    热门文章最新推荐

    版权与免责声明:
    ① 本网转载其他媒体稿件是为传播更多的信息,此类稿件不代表本网观点,版权归原作者所有,本网不承担此类稿件侵权行为的连带责任。
    ② 本站原创文章,转载时请注明出自文谷及作者姓名
    ③在本网BBS上发表言论者,文责自负。
    ④如您因版权等问题需要与本网联络,请在30日内联系 。
    SCJP 中文大纲SCJP 中文大纲2006-7-18 22:56:58SCJP 中文大纲2006-7-18 22:56:58SCJP 中文大纲
    SCJP 中文大纲SCJP 中文大纲2006-7-18 22:56:58SCJP 中文大纲2006-7-18 22:56:58SCJP 中文大纲

    全站热点
    最新推荐
    关于文谷 | 联系文谷 | 免责声明 | 文谷论坛
    Tel: 0577-65690019      E-mail: ichenjian@gmail.com    MSN:ichenjian@hotmail.com    QQ:2911194
    Copyright © 2004-2008 wengu.com 文谷 All Rights Reserved
    浙ICP备05000327号